/linux/drivers/gpu/drm/ |
H A D | drm_bridge_helper.c | 36 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, ctx); in drm_bridge_helper_reset_crtc() 57 drm_modeset_unlock(&dev->mode_config.connection_mutex); in drm_bridge_helper_reset_crtc()
|
H A D | drm_encoder.c | 349 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in drm_mode_getencoder() 355 drm_modeset_unlock(&dev->mode_config.connection_mutex); in drm_mode_getencoder()
|
H A D | drm_atomic.c | 1027 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, ctx); in drm_atomic_get_connector_for_encoder() 1042 drm_modeset_unlock(&dev->mode_config.connection_mutex); in drm_atomic_get_connector_for_encoder() 1133 ret = drm_modeset_lock(&config->connection_mutex, state->acquire_ctx); in drm_atomic_get_connector_state() 1366 ret = drm_modeset_lock(&config->connection_mutex, state->acquire_ctx); in drm_atomic_add_affected_connectors() 1644 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, in update_output_state() 1863 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in __drm_state_dump() 1867 drm_modeset_unlock(&dev->mode_config.connection_mutex); in __drm_state_dump()
|
H A D | drm_mode_config.c | 429 drm_modeset_lock_init(&dev->mode_config.connection_mutex); in drmm_mode_config_init() 471 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, in drmm_mode_config_init() 583 drm_modeset_lock_fini(&dev->mode_config.connection_mutex); in drm_mode_config_cleanup()
|
H A D | drm_probe_helper.c | 364 ret = drm_modeset_lock(&connector->dev->mode_config.connection_mutex, &ctx); in drm_helper_probe_detect_ctx() 406 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, ctx); in drm_helper_probe_detect() 575 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, &ctx); in drm_helper_probe_single_connector_modes()
|
H A D | drm_connector.c | 2808 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in drm_connector_set_link_status_property() 2810 drm_modeset_unlock(&dev->mode_config.connection_mutex); in drm_connector_set_link_status_property() 3167 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in drm_connector_privacy_screen_notifier() 3169 drm_modeset_unlock(&dev->mode_config.connection_mutex); in drm_connector_privacy_screen_notifier() 3431 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in drm_mode_getconnector() 3445 drm_modeset_unlock(&dev->mode_config.connection_mutex); in drm_mode_getconnector()
|
H A D | drm_debugfs.c | 699 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); \ 714 drm_modeset_unlock(&dev->mode_config.connection_mutex); \
|
H A D | drm_atomic_uapi.c | 892 WARN_ON(!drm_modeset_is_locked(&dev->mode_config.connection_mutex)); in drm_atomic_get_property() 954 ret = drm_modeset_lock(&state->dev->mode_config.connection_mutex, in drm_atomic_connector_commit_dpms()
|
H A D | drm_crtc_helper.c | 121 drm_WARN_ON(dev, !drm_modeset_is_locked(&dev->mode_config.connection_mutex)); in drm_helper_encoder_in_use()
|
/linux/drivers/gpu/drm/vboxvideo/ |
H A D | vbox_irq.c | 128 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in vbox_update_mode_hints() 160 drm_modeset_unlock(&dev->mode_config.connection_mutex); in vbox_update_mode_hints()
|
/linux/drivers/gpu/drm/i915/display/ |
H A D | intel_display_debugfs.c | 899 ret = drm_modeset_lock(&display->drm->mode_config.connection_mutex, in i915_dsc_fec_support_show() 1012 ret = drm_modeset_lock_single_interruptible(&display->drm->mode_config.connection_mutex); in i915_dsc_bpc_show() 1025 out: dr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in i915_dsc_bpc_show() 1078 ret = drm_modeset_lock_single_interruptible(&display->drm->mode_config.connection_mutex); in i915_dsc_output_format_show() 1092 out: dr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in i915_dsc_output_format_show() 1145 ret = drm_modeset_lock_single_interruptible(&display->drm->mode_config.connection_mutex); in i915_dsc_fractional_bpp_show() 1160 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in i915_dsc_fractional_bpp_show()
|
H A D | intel_link_bw.c | 430 err = drm_modeset_lock_single_interruptible(&display->drm->mode_config.connection_mutex); in force_link_bpp_write() 436 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in force_link_bpp_write()
|
H A D | intel_panel.c | 483 ret = drm_modeset_lock(&display->drm->mode_config.connection_mutex, NULL); in intel_panel_sync_state() 502 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in intel_panel_sync_state()
|
H A D | intel_alpm.c | 518 ret = drm_modeset_lock_single_interruptible(&display->drm->mode_config.connection_mutex); in i915_edp_lobf_info_show() 537 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in i915_edp_lobf_info_show()
|
H A D | intel_hdcp.c | 1196 drm_modeset_lock(&display->drm->mode_config.connection_mutex, NULL); in intel_hdcp_prop_work() 1209 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in intel_hdcp_prop_work() 2671 * requires connection_mutex which could be held while calling this in intel_hdcp_cleanup() 2792 ret = drm_modeset_lock_single_interruptible(&display->drm->mode_config.connection_mutex); in intel_hdcp_sink_capability_show() 2807 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in intel_hdcp_sink_capability_show() 2848 ret = drm_modeset_lock_single_interruptible(&display->drm->mode_config.connection_mutex); in intel_hdcp_force_14_show() 2861 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in intel_hdcp_force_14_show()
|
H A D | intel_backlight.c | 315 * connection_mutex isn't held across the entire backlight in intel_backlight_set_acpi() 875 drm_modeset_lock(&display->drm->mode_config.connection_mutex, NULL); in intel_backlight_device_update_status() 898 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in intel_backlight_device_update_status() 912 drm_modeset_lock(&display->drm->mode_config.connection_mutex, NULL); in intel_backlight_device_get_brightness() 918 drm_modeset_unlock(&display->drm->mode_config.connection_mutex); in intel_backlight_device_get_brightness()
|
H A D | intel_overlay.c | 811 !drm_modeset_is_locked(&display->drm->mode_config.connection_mutex)); in intel_overlay_do_put_image() 916 !drm_modeset_is_locked(&display->drm->mode_config.connection_mutex)); in intel_overlay_switch_off()
|
H A D | intel_dp_test.c | 460 ret = drm_modeset_lock(&display->drm->mode_config.connection_mutex, in intel_dp_do_phy_test()
|
/linux/drivers/gpu/drm/nouveau/ |
H A D | nouveau_backlight.c | 128 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, &ctx); in nv50_edp_get_brightness() 171 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, &ctx); in nv50_edp_set_brightness()
|
/linux/drivers/gpu/drm/amd/display/amdgpu_dm/ |
H A D | amdgpu_dm_debugfs.c | 1375 ret = drm_modeset_lock(&dev->mode_config.connection_mutex, &ctx); in dp_dsc_fec_support_show() 1685 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in dp_dsc_clock_en_write() 1714 drm_modeset_unlock(&dev->mode_config.connection_mutex); in dp_dsc_clock_en_write() 1869 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in dp_dsc_slice_width_write() 1898 drm_modeset_unlock(&dev->mode_config.connection_mutex); in dp_dsc_slice_width_write() 2053 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in dp_dsc_slice_height_write() 2082 drm_modeset_unlock(&dev->mode_config.connection_mutex); in dp_dsc_slice_height_write() 2230 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in dp_dsc_bits_per_pixel_write() 2254 drm_modeset_unlock(&dev->mode_config.connection_mutex); in dp_dsc_bits_per_pixel_write() 2551 drm_modeset_lock(&dev->mode_config.connection_mutex, NUL in dp_max_bpc_read() [all...] |
H A D | amdgpu_dm_hdcp.c | 357 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in event_property_update() 390 drm_modeset_unlock(&dev->mode_config.connection_mutex); in event_property_update()
|
/linux/include/drm/ |
H A D | drm_mode_config.h | 374 * @connection_mutex: 381 struct drm_modeset_lock connection_mutex; member
|
/linux/drivers/gpu/drm/bridge/cadence/ |
H A D | cdns-mhdp8546-hdcp.c | 493 drm_modeset_lock(&dev->mode_config.connection_mutex, NULL); in cdns_mhdp_hdcp_prop_work() 500 drm_modeset_unlock(&dev->mode_config.connection_mutex); in cdns_mhdp_hdcp_prop_work()
|
/linux/drivers/gpu/drm/display/ |
H A D | drm_hdcp_helper.c | 413 WARN_ON(!drm_modeset_is_locked(&dev->mode_config.connection_mutex)); in drm_hdcp_update_content_protection()
|
/linux/drivers/gpu/drm/amd/amdgpu/ |
H A D | amdgpu_drv.c | 2738 drm_modeset_lock(&drm_dev->mode_config.connection_mutex, NULL); in amdgpu_runtime_idle_check_display() 2750 drm_modeset_unlock(&drm_dev->mode_config.connection_mutex); in amdgpu_runtime_idle_check_display()
|